Problems of synthesis of connected networks with respect to isomorphic subgraphs

Cybernetics and Systems Analysis, 2004
This paper deals with problems of minimum-cost network synthesis under the condition that at least one pair of nodes remains connected by a path after eliminating all the edges of a subgraph isomorphic to a given graph. The existence of solutions of such problems is investigated for different isomorphic subgraphs.
